Kinds of Headphones
When trying to find headphones, it is necessary to understand the different types available in the market. Below is a summary of the main classifications:
1. Over-Ear HeadphonesDescription: These headphones cover the entire ear, often supplying outstanding sound seclusion and comfort.Best For: Home listening and studio work.2. On-Ear HeadphonesDescription: On-ear headphones rest on the external ear. They tend to be more portable than over-ear designs however might not supply as much sound isolation.Best For: Casual listening and travel.3. In-Ear Headphones (Earbuds)Description: These fit directly in the ear canal and are extremely portable. They use differing sound quality and sound seclusion depending on the model.Best For: On-the-go listening and exercising.4. Wireless HeadphonesDescription: These lack physical wires, usually connecting through Bluetooth innovation. Lots of designs also include noise-cancellation technology.Best For: Movement during workouts or commuting.5. Noise-Cancelling HeadphonesDescription: These headphones actively block out ambient noise, making them best for loud environments.Best For: Travel and focused listening.6. Gaming HeadsetsDescription: Designed for gaming, these frequently come with a built-in microphone and noise functions customized for immersive gameplay.Best For: Gamers who desire a competitive edge.7. Are wired headphones better than wireless ones?
Wired headphones typically offer better sound quality and low latency, while wireless headphones supply benefit and portability. The choice depends upon individual choice and particular usage cases.
2. Is sound cancellation worth it?
Noise cancellation can substantially boost the listening experience, specifically in loud environments. If you frequently find yourself in crowded areas or traveling, buying noise-cancelling headphones can be useful.
3. How do I keep my headphones?
To keep headphones, clean them frequently, avoid exposing them to wetness, store them securely, and prevent twisting wires (for wired designs).
